Guest Artist Series: Alyssa Low

To celebrate our upcoming Southport cafe opening, we partnered with Chicago artist and multidisciplinary designer Alyssa Low for the newest release in our Guest Artist Series.

Like many of our cafe openings, this collaboration is rooted in community, creativity and a shared sense of place. Alyssa’s limited-edition design captures the spirit of the Southport neighborhood through bold color, geometric forms and coffee-inspired iconography—all wrapped around one of our everyday offerings: Co-Optiva Farm Blend.

Inspired by Southport, Chicago

This concept blends Southport’s local identity with Colectivo Coffee’s creative spirit. Inspired by the neighborhood’s architecture, lakefront setting, and gridded streets, the design uses simplified geometric forms to express a strong sense of place. Clouds, sun, waves, and rooftops evoke the outdoors, while vertical “SOUTHPORT” lettering anchors the location. References to coffee culture—roasted beans, a steaming mug with a Chicago star, and pour-over silhouettes—celebrate the ritual of brewing, balancing organic warmth with urban structure. 

Meet Alyssa Low

Alyssa Low is a Chicago artist and multidisciplinary designer whose work explores the dynamic relationship between color, shape, and composition.

Her visual style combines minimalistic forms, bold colors and modular storytelling to create narratives filled with mementos and iconography. Over the years, she has collaborated with a wide range of clients spanning nationally recognized brands and local institutions alike—including Nike, Wayfair, Cava, Vuori, the Chicago Bulls and the Chicago Blackhawks.

The Coffee: Co-Optiva

Inside the bag is Co-Optiva—one of our longtime everyday offerings and a favorite morning friend.

Co-Optiva is a celebration of the small-scale farmers who are committed to quality in the cup. We've combined organic coffees produced by Fair Trade cooperatives in Central and South America with whom we have built long-standing relationships over the years.

Expect balanced flavors reminiscent of nectarine and caramel.
